    In player.json

    "Start Engine":false,
    "Start Engine#":"Whether to automatically start engine",

    When you join room your engine is off.

    Set a ignition and starter button.

    With ignition off you will notice some of the Hud menus are "Not available"
    Turn ignition on they are activated.

    Car LEDs power on with ignition as well.


    Using ignition to join others from pits enter your car 5 seconds sooner then normal. ;)
